Choose the Perfect Space

To make your movie marathon experience feel more like you're in a theater than in your own home, it's important to choose the best space. If you think that any room in your home with a screen and a chair will do, then think again. Here are some helpful tips to making sure you pick the perfect spot to tune into your favorite holiday flicks this season:

  • Choose a space that can be closed off from the rest of the house to limit distractions, including loud noises and strong smells.
  • Avoid picking a room that will be used for a variety of purposes. You don't want your holiday vibe to be ruined by someone trying to exercise or do homework right next to you, after all!

Control the Lighting

How your home theater is illuminated can make or break its entire atmosphere. While maximizing the amount of natural light in every other space in your home is typically desirable, the exact opposite is true for your movie room. The darker the room, the better to bring your dreams of creating a personal theater in your home to life. Be sure to block out any light that could spill into the space, including from underneath the door, through the windows, or even from electronics within the room.

Be Strategic About Seating

Along with having a room that is quiet and dark, you'll want to consider the seating arrangement in your theater area to ensure your holiday movie marathon is as joyful as possible. Before investing in oversized chairs or a new sofa, keep these seating factors in mind:

  • How many seats will your family need? How many can the room comfortably hold?
  • Where should you position them within the room for everyone to have a clear view of the screen?
  • Are the seats you have in mind comfortable?

Keep It Simple

The great thing about creating a place to watch movies in your home is that it won't require an array of fancy decorations. In fact, it's best to keep the decor and accessories in your personal theater to a minimum, especially around the screen. Having too much decor can distract from your holiday movie marathon. If you do choose to hang things on the wall, consider doing so in the back of the room. Then they won't compete with the star of the space: the movie.
